Existing Uses - These provisions do not apply <br />to non-recreational uses being made of an area <br />or facility at the time the program-assisted <br />prOject is approved, when such uses are known <br />to and approved by the Texas Parks and Wildlife <br />Department and documented in the project <br />proposal. <br /> <br />OPERATION AND MAINTENANCE <br /> <br />Property developed with program assistance shall be <br />operated and maintained as follows: <br /> <br />A. The property shall be maintained so as to appear <br />attractive and inviting to the public. <br /> <br />B. Sanitation and sanitary facilities shall be <br />maintained in accordance with applicable health <br />standards. <br /> <br />C. Properties shall be kept reasonably safe for <br />public use. <br /> <br />D. Buildings, roads, trails, and other structures and <br />improvements shall be kept in reasonable repair <br />throughout their estimated lifetime to prevent <br />undue deterioration and to encourage public use. <br />It is not necessary that assisted <br />structures/improvements be maintained in <br />perpetuity. Once assisted improvements/ <br />structures have exceeded their estimated <br />lifetime. or they are no lonaer economicallv <br />feasible to operate or maintain, they may be <br />demolished. renovated, redeveloped as lono as <br />the area remains in public recreation use and <br />prior Texas Parks and Wildlife Department <br />approval is received. <br /> <br />E. The facility shall be kept open for public use at <br />reasonable hours and times of the year, <br />according to the type of area or facility. <br /> <br />AVAlLABIITY TO USERS <br /> <br />A. Non-Discrimination - Property developed with <br />program assistance shall be open to entry and <br />use by all persons regardless of age, race, color, <br />sex, national origin, or handicap who are <br />otherwise eligible. Discrimination on the basis of <br />residence, including preferential reservation or <br />membership systems, is prohibited, except to the <br />extent that reasonable differences in admission <br />or other fees may be maintained on the basis of <br />residence. <br /> <br />B. Reasonable Use Limitations - Participants <br />may impose reasonable limits on the type and <br />extent of use of the areas and facilities acquired <br />or developed with program assistance when <br />such a limitation is necessary for maintenance or <br />preservation. Thus, limitations may be imposed <br />on the number of persons using an area or <br />facility or the type of users such as hunters only <br />or hikers only.
